Bruno Mars on Billboard: Chart Record Exclusive

Bruno Mars keeps rewriting the record books. I Just Might, the lead single off his album The Romantic, has now spent 22 weeks at No. 1 on Billboard's Hot R&B/Hip-Hop Songs chart, tying Kendrick Lamar's Not Like Us as the second-longest-running No. 1 in the chart's history. The only song ahead of them now is Kendrick and SZA's Luther, which holds the all-time record at 31 weeks.
